Your day at NTT DATA
The Skilled Critical Facilities Maintenance Technician has a substantial understanding of their role and applies their knowledge and skill to carry out their responsibilities relating to the operational integrity and regulatory compliance of the data center electrical, mechanical, and fire life safety systems.
This role maintains and follows the processes that maximize customer uptime in the most cost-effective way. This role also ensures that data center problems are identified and repaired quickly, that contractors deliver quality services, and that internal customer demands are met.
The Skilled Critical Facilities Maintenance Technician acts as an informal team leader, fostering a collaborative and innovative team culture focused on achieving operational excellence.
Key responsibilities:
- Develops creative approaches to keeping operational costs to a minimum, improves efficiency, and implements new strategies. Systems of responsibility include -
- Mechanical responsibilities include chilled water systems and components, HVAC systems such as roof top units, CRAC/CRAH units, and humidification systems.
- Electrical responsibilities include electrical/critical power distribution from the Utility/Generator main switchgear through the UPS systems out to the customer load.
- Fire Life Safety responsibilities includes wet sprinkler systems and pre-action sprinkler systems as well as their associated detection devices.
- Tests performance of electromechanical assemblies and electronic voltmeters.
- Reads blueprints, schematics, diagrams, or technical order to determine methods and sequences of processes.
- Inspects parts for surface defects.
- Installs electrical or electronic parts and hardware in housings or assemblies, using hand tools.
- Aligns, fits or assembles component parts, using hand or power tools.
- Operates, monitors, maintains, and responds to abnormal conditions in facilities systems. Areas include - Mechanical, Electrical, Fire Life Safety, and Building Monitoring and Control.
- Analyses systems to ensure best practices for both internal and external customers.
- Provides feedback to relevant teams on the effectiveness of existing standards and processes.
- Works with contractors and consultants to review quality assurance for all system expansions, corrections, and upgrades.
- Works with relevant teams to track and complete an aggressive preventive and predictive maintenance program.
- Ensures data center operates at maximum operational efficiency, including analyzing existing operating conditions, recommending new technologies and improving overall efficiency, and cost reduction.
- Manages systems to avoid unplanned customer-impacting events.
- Works with relevant teams to determine maintenance requirements for mechanical, electrical, and fire life safety systems.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
Knowledge, Skills and Attributes:
- Understanding of the mechanical, electrical, and fire life safety systems used in a data center environment including, but not limited to the following - electrical distribution and layout, Transformers, PLC's, Generators, Switchgear, UPS systems, STS', ATS' PDU's, Chilled Water Systems, CRAC/CRAH's, Pre-Action Sprinkler Systems.
- Knowledge of NEC, NFPA 70E, NFPA 72, NFPA 25, and compliance issues as well as building codes in regard to fire life safety.
- Current knowledge in industrial safety best practices (i.e. lockout/tag out, arc flash protection, OSHA and state regulations).
